The fees for the SIT40521 Certificate IV in Kitchen Management at ACTT College are $21,250.
The course duration is 80 weeks Full Time including Holidays.
This qualification requires students to undertake work placement. Specifically, the unit SITHCCC043 Work effectively as a cook requires a minimum of 48 complete service periods (shifts) that include Breakfast, Lunch, Dinner and Special Functions, at least 3 different menu styles (à la carte, set menu, table d'hôte, buffet or cyclical), and a range of food types. ACTT College has allocated 4-5 hours per service period (shift) in a commercial kitchen.
The course is delivered at Level 1, 11-13 Aird St, Parramatta NSW 2150.
This qualification provides a pathway to work as a cook in various establishments such as restaurants, hotels, clubs, pubs, cafes, and coffee shops. Further training pathways from this qualification may lead to the SIT50422 Diploma of Hospitality Management.
